Cloud 9

Cloud 9

A Poem by Trapped

It’s calling me,

The pull is as strong as ever,

Must,

Resist,

The,

Burning,

Temptation.


It’s not working,

I’m trying,

I'm crying,

But nothing works.


It’s happening again,

I gave in to the pull,

It felt so good,

Like I was floating on a cloud,

Pure bliss coursed through me,

When I stopped,

It disappeared,

Leaving me with a feeling,

Of being hollow.


On comes the craving,

The pull returns,

I find myself back again,

Replaying the night before.


What’s wrong with me?

Why do I put myself through this torture?

Why am I an addict?

Why,

Am I,

Me?
